Vickerys Bar Grill Downtown

Menu offers american cuisine with a Cuban flare, Cuban sandwich, black beans and rice, grilled salmon BLT, fried Cajun popcorn, and Lowcountry saute.

dont waste a meal in Charleston on this place!

My husband and I had dinner here last weekend, and I was so disappointed. I'd been in 1995 and really enjoyed it, but everything, from the bored, above-it-all waitress, to dirty silverware, to smoke drifting into the dining room from the bar, to the awful food was a huge let down. I ordered the seafood on grits, which arrive FLOATING in a nauseating sea of red grease. I couldn't even try it, so I switched with hubby (who said the flavor was OK) and ate his scallops and shrimp on penne. The seafood tasted OK, but the penne was mush, and pesto-like sauce was tasteless and it all sat in deep pool of oil. I'm not a health nut by any means, but all that oil just grossed me out.
